select identity(int,1,1) kk,* into #t from T
select * from #t今天逛论坛看见的,不小心在我的数据库里面用了,但是我不知道什么意思
还有这个#t放在哪里了,怎么找到它,还有要怎样删除它。

解决方案 »

  1.   

    identity(int,1,1)  自动编号,相当于记录行数临时表在一个查询里可以按删除表来删除也就是 drop table #t 。
      

  2.   

    #t 临时表,在使用过程中,即会话过程中,查看tempdb可以看到这张表。
    退出会话此表将被自动回收。
      

  3.   

    drop table tempdb..#t
    go
      

  4.   

    #t是临时表,存放在系统数据库tempdb中。
    临时表有两种类型:本地表和全局表。
    在与首次创建或引用表时相同的 SQL Server 实例连接期间,本地临时表只对于创建者是可见的。当用户与 SQL Server 实例断开连接后,将删除本地临时表。
    全局临时表在创建后对任何用户和任何连接都是可见的,当引用该表的所有用户都与 SQL Server 实例断开连接后,将删除全局临时表